Monopole and dipole layers in curved spacetimes: formalism and examples
Abstract
The discontinuities of electromagnetic test fields generated by general layers of electric and magnetic monopoles and dipoles are investigated in general curved spacetimes. The equivalence of electric currents and magnetic dipoles is discussed. The results are used to describe exact "Schwarzschild disk" solutions endowed with such sources. The resulting distributions of charge and dipole densities on the disks are corroborated using the membrane paradigm.
